Rebooted Home Page

Sometimes my internet’s home page leaves me puzzled. What is deemed headlines and important leaves my little heart and mind so confused and often in despair. This morning I quickly closed down the computer and set off for a quiet walk in nature. There, without even bothering to announce his presence with his song, sat a magnificent Magpie. Content with just sitting in less than 30 degrees, the ever present wind, and the awkward stillness of the tree he had chosen. Simply being.

 

From there another walk through the neighborhood. I laughed with the tall evergreen/pine trees twittering so loud with what must have been a flock of small birds hidden in the branches. I chatted with a raven as he pulled and pulled on a tree’s thin twig only to discover he was standing on the twig. He turned his head and chose another twig on a different branch. Again, he discovered the wind played with him and brushed it away as he grabbed it with his beak. He almost “fell off” his perch. With no agenda other than to be a contented Magpie I walked through the neighborhood and offered blessings to each car that passed. Two elderly gentlemen stood in a yard contemplating a ladder, a saw, and a tree. I smiled and offered success to their venture. I offered good mornings to the dogs that ran to the fence to bark and watched their tails wag vigorously back and forth. I bellowed out loud to see a little dog’s nose and one eye peer through a hole in a wooden fence.  Returning I put out the seed and watched the pigeons circle overhead and the sole raven scout began to caw to the others who flew in for the breakfast buffet.

 

A different kind of home page and news. But maybe, just maybe, within this tapestry of interconnected Life, a magnificent Magpie and a little hobbit walking, a thread of simple joy has been woven.  And maybe, just maybe, if such a simple musing gifts whoever should read a smile, the thread will grow.
